About this map

The Custer National Forest anchors this mid-1960s topographic survey of Powder River County, revealing a landscape defined by intermittent water sources and the varied topography of the Hodsdon Flats. The map documents a rugged cattle-country environment where life centers on managed water access, notably at Callaway Reservoir and Turtle Reservoir. Family names and local history are etched into the terrain through landmarks like Gardner Butte and Bailey Hill, as well as numerous named draws and prongs such as Mason Prong and Bloom Prong.
